Overview
Start your journey by meeting your guide in front of Rustaveli Metro Station, the first and oldest metro station in Georgia. From there, dive into the city's underground world as you ride the metro, experiencing its deepest escalator, which takes 2.5 minutes to descend. Travel through several stations as your local guide shares the fascinating history of Tbilisi’s railway, how it began, evolved, and operates today.
Step off the usual tourist path to see an active mine from the 20th century and explore an abandoned electric depot with a mysterious past. Pass by the historic home of Georgia’s first railway workers, which is rich with stories of the city's railway heritage. Along the way, glimpse abandoned buildings now housing war refugees and hear how they’ve rebuilt their lives with resilience and hope.
But the highlight of the day? A secret, closed-off repair station, hidden from the public.
This is not just a tour. It’s an exclusive adventure into hidden and forbidden locations you won’t find alone. With stories passed down through generations and untold history that never made it into books, this tour uncovers Tbilisi's underground secrets through a local's eyes.
